A BMI of 18.5-24.9 indicates that a person is at a healthy weight for their height. This will help lower the risk of developing serious health problems. A BMI of 25-29.9 indicates that the person is slightly overweight. A doctor or dietitian may advise one to lose weight for health reasons.

When the BMI is over 30 that indicates that a person is heavily overweight. Their health may be at risk if weight loss is not addressed. With this being the case, the following can occur:

1. High blood pressure can increase. Blood cholesterol and triglyceride levels increase.
2. It lowers the HDL (high-density lipoproteins) or good cholesterol
3. Diabetes and other health problems can occur
4. Type 2 diabetes can occur
5. Stroke
6. Osteoarthritis
7. Sleep apnea
8. Some forms of cancers (breast and colon cancer)
